......@@ -503,7 +503,7 @@ class DecoderBlock3D(ConvolutionalBlock3D):
# ATTENTION: As of this code version, only "upconv" works! Debugging is ongoing for upconv and upsample!
# It seems that errors are generated by variable filter sizes and the unorthodox input sizes 91x109x91.
if self.up_mode == 'upconv':
if self.up_mode == 'unpool':
upsampling = self.up(X, pool_indices, output_size=Y_encoder.size())
elif self.up_mode == 'upsample':
upsampling = self.up(X)
